1 I n my distress I cried to the Lord, and He answered me.
2 D eliver me, O Lord, from lying lips and from deceitful tongues.
3 W hat shall be given to you? Or what more shall be done to you, you deceitful tongue?—
4 S harp arrows of a warrior, with coals of the broom tree!
5 W oe is me that I sojourn with Meshech, that I dwell beside the tents of Kedar!
6 M y life has too long had its dwelling with him who hates peace.
7 I am for peace; but when I speak, they are for war.
